import logging
from quantumclient.quantum.v2_0 import CreateCommand
from quantumclient.quantum.v2_0 import DeleteCommand
from quantumclient.quantum.v2_0 import ListCommand
from quantumclient.quantum.v2_0 import ShowCommand
from quantumclient.quantum.v2_0 import UpdateCommand
def _format_fixed_ips(port):
try:
return '\n'.join(port['fixed_ips'])
except Exception:
return ''
class ListPort(ListCommand):
"""List networks that belong to a given tenant
Sample: list_ports -D -- --name=test4 --tag a b
"""
resource = 'port'
log = logging.getLogger(__name__ + '.ListPort')
_formatters = {'fixed_ips': _format_fixed_ips, }
class ShowPort(ShowCommand):
"""Show information of a given port
Sample: show_port -D <port_id>
"""
resource = 'port'
log = logging.getLogger(__name__ + '.ShowPort')
class CreatePort(CreateCommand):
"""Create a port for a given tenant
Sample create_port --tenant-id xxx --admin-state-down \
--mac_address mac --device_id deviceid <network_id>
"""
resource = 'port'
log = logging.getLogger(__name__ + '.CreatePort')
def add_known_arguments(self, parser):
parser.add_argument(
'--admin-state-down',
default=True, action='store_false',
help='set admin state up to false')
parser.add_argument(
'--mac-address',
help='mac address of port')
parser.add_argument(
'--device-id',
help='device id of this port')
parser.add_argument(
'network_id',
help='Network id of this port belongs to')
def args2body(self, parsed_args):
body = {'port': {'admin_state_up': parsed_args.admin_state_down,
'network_id': parsed_args.network_id, }, }
if parsed_args.mac_address:
body['port'].update({'mac_address': parsed_args.mac_address})
if parsed_args.device_id:
body['port'].update({'device_id': parsed_args.device_id})
if parsed_args.tenant_id:
body['port'].update({'tenant_id': parsed_args.tenant_id})
return body
class DeletePort(DeleteCommand):
"""Delete a given port
Sample: delete_port <port_id>
"""
resource = 'port'
log = logging.getLogger(__name__ + '.DeletePort')
class UpdatePort(UpdateCommand):
"""Update port's information
Sample: update_port <port_id> --name=test --admin_state_up type=bool True
"""
resource = 'port'
log = logging.getLogger(__name__ + '.UpdatePort')
